We are a specialized plumbing company dedicated to serving large-scale single-family rental property owners. Our team provides essential plumbing services to thousands of rental homes across the southern United States."
A. Overview of Responsibilities
As an Invoicing Clerk, you will be responsible for ensuring that all invoices are accurately processed and paid in a timely manner. This means that you will need to have a strong attention to detail and be able to work quickly and efficiently.
Employees must have the following :
- Work from home
- Using your own computer
- Good / reliable internet
- Must be available for 3-4 hours a day between 8am-12pm CST - this is mandatory
- Previous plumbing experience a huge plus
- 15 / hour
- Must write well. The invoices have summaries of what the problem was and what the solution was that we did to solve the issues. This must be relayed on the invoices.
Other responsibilities of an Invoicing Clerk may include but are not limited to :
Creating and maintaining accurate records of all invoicesReconciling discrepancies in invoices and receiptsResponding to customer inquiries regarding billing and invoicingB. Specific Duties of Invoicing Clerk
Some of the specific duties that an Invoicing Clerk may be responsible for include :
Entering data into computer systems to create invoicesReviewing and editing notes, photos, and pricing submitted by field technicians before invoicingEnsuring that pricing complies with pre-negotiated rates for each clientCharging appropriate sales tax when applicablePreparing and sending out invoices to customersVerifying the accuracy of invoices before sending them outReconciling payments received with outstanding invoices-future dutiesFollowing up with customers regarding overdue invoices-future dutiesDeveloping and implementing procedures for efficient invoicing processes-future dutiesC.
